Accra, May 19, GNA – The Ninth Parliament of the Fourth Republic will resume Sitting on Thursday, May 21, 2026, Speaker of Parliament, Mr Alban Sumana Kingsford Bagbin has announced.
In a formal notice issued from the Office of the Speaker, and made available to the Ghana News Agency, it stated that the Second Meeting of the Second Session would commence at 1000 hours at Parliament House, Accra.
“The convening is in accordance with Order 58 of the Standing Orders of the Parliament of Ghana,” the noticed signed by Mr Bagbin said.
Lawmakers are expected to return to Parliament House to continue legislative business for the Session.
The upcoming Meeting will be the second for the Second Session of the current Parliament.
The House adjourned sine die on Friday, March 27, for the Easter festivities.
